About the role
Key responsibilities & impact- Support the planning and execution of complex, cross‑functional M&A‑led projects, owning defined components such as project goals, schedules, milestone tracking, and budget-related activities (including budget development, cost tracking, and reporting).
- Develop and co-support the overall transaction and workstream structure;
- Coordinate with workstream leads (HR, Finance, IT, Legal, Supply Chain, etc.) to develop and execute integration/divestment plans across sign-to-close and post-close phases.
- Develop and manage integrated project plans, ensuring appropriate resources are assigned and milestones are met, while regularly communicating progress to stakeholders.
- Support and manage synergy, TSA (Transition Service Agreement), separation/integration milestones, risks, and interdependencies.
- Act as a primary point of contact across all transaction stakeholders supporting the preparation of presentations, executive and steering committee papers, and decision-making packs, to support transaction execution
- Work with business partners to design, introduce, or re-engineer existing processes
- Utilize skills in conflict management and team building to foster a collaborative environment, resolving issues and risks that may arise during project execution.
- Applying strategic thinking skills to identify potential scenarios, evaluate their impact and risk, and make informed decisions that directly affect outcomes.
- Ensure all projects are completed in accordance with all Risk, Control, and other relevant guidelines, maintaining our control environment
Requirements
What you’ll need- Mandatory 2–5 years prior experience in IMO or DMO roles, supporting integration or divestment workstreams.
- Experience across M&A integration, divestment planning, separation readiness, TSA management, Day 1 planning, and synergy tracking
- A solid understanding of key stages and phases of deal preparation and execution processes.
- Excellent oral and written communication skills, as well as interpersonal skills
- Experience with communicating with and presenting to senior internal and external stakeholders
- Familiarity with integration/divestment frameworks, playbooks, and best-practice methodologies
- Excellent problem solving and analytical skills
- Experience working with external consultants and remote team members
- Bachelor's degree in Finance, Economics, Business, or related field.
